Yamaha MX775V-EFI, MX800V-EFI, MX825V-EFI, MX800V, MX825V F.A.Q.

What is the recommended oil type for the Yamaha MX775V-EFI engine?

The recommended oil type for the Yamaha MX775V-EFI engine is SAE 10W-30 for general use. Always refer to the owner’s manual for specific recommendations based on your operating environment.

How can I troubleshoot starting issues with my Yamaha MX800V-EFI?

If your Yamaha MX800V-EFI is having trouble starting, check the battery charge, ensure fuel is reaching the engine, inspect the spark plugs for wear, and verify the EFI system is functioning correctly.

What is the maintenance interval for the air filter on a Yamaha MX825V-EFI?

The air filter on a Yamaha MX825V-EFI should be inspected and cleaned every 50 hours of operation or more frequently in dusty conditions. Replace it as necessary.

Can I use E10 fuel with my Yamaha MX800V engine?

Yes, the Yamaha MX800V engine can use E10 fuel, which contains up to 10% ethanol. However, using ethanol-free fuel is recommended for optimal performance.

What should I do if my Yamaha MX825V overheats?

If your Yamaha MX825V overheats, stop the engine immediately and let it cool down. Check for coolant leaks, ensure the radiator is clean, and verify the cooling fan is operational.

How do I perform a carburetor adjustment on a Yamaha MX800V?

To adjust the carburetor on a Yamaha MX800V, first warm up the engine, then adjust the idle mixture screw and idle speed screw according to the specifications in the service manual.

What spark plug type is recommended for the Yamaha MX775V-EFI?

The recommended spark plug for the Yamaha MX775V-EFI is NGK BPR5ES or an equivalent. Always check the gap before installation.

How often should I change the oil in my Yamaha MX825V-EFI?

The oil in the Yamaha MX825V-EFI should be changed every 100 hours of operation or annually, whichever comes first. More frequent changes may be needed in harsh conditions.

What could cause rough idling in a Yamaha MX800V-EFI engine?

Rough idling in a Yamaha MX800V-EFI engine could be caused by dirty fuel injectors, a clogged air filter, or incorrect spark plug gaps. Inspect these components and service as necessary.

How do I winterize my Yamaha MX825V engine?

To winterize your Yamaha MX825V engine, drain the fuel or add a stabilizer, change the oil, remove the battery and store it in a warm place, and cover the engine to protect it from moisture.
